Dear Board of Directors:
Following Hurricane Katrina, many individuals have been displaced and may no longer be able to access their primary financial institution.
NCUA encourages credit unions to consider reasonable and prudent steps to assist individuals, who have been displaced by Hurricane Katrina and/or are located in areas damaged by Hurricane Katrina.
To assist with opening of new accounts and processing of non-member transactions, NCUA, federal banking regulators, and the Financial Crimes Enforcement Network have joined together to provide the enclosed guidance concerning compliance with the Bank Secrecy Act (BSA).
If you have other questions about BSA, please contact your regional office, examiner, or state supervisory authority.
